WebFirst, the Cherokee alphabet is technically not an alphabet at all, but a syllabary. That means each Cherokee symbol represents a syllable, not just a consonant or a vowel. WebWhiskers are also known as vibrissae or tactile hairs. These stiff “hairs” grow all over your cat’s body—not just on their face!
